The UIC QP Case Competition Celebration Ceremony was held on 29th December 2010 in Room B101. In the 2nd HKICPA QP Case Competition (2010), two excellent UIC teams stood out from more than 200 teams nationwide and won the Championship and Award of Merit. The second and third places were respectively taken by Zhongnan University of Economics and Law and Jiangxi University of Finance and Economics.
There were 239 teams from universities all over mainland China participated in that 2010's competition, including many top universities such as Peking University, Tsinghua University, and Shanghai Jiao Tong University. 14 teams of UIC business students took part in the competition and 8 of them entered into the second round. Finally, two teams were shortlisted into the Final Round. One team coached by Mr. Joseph Liang won the Championship and another team supervised by Mr. Ben Wong received an Award of Merit.

Both wining teams came from the Year 3 Accounting major. The four members of Champion team were Huang Beibei (Leader), Sun Meiyue, Tan Jingyan and Ye Jinwen. The Award of Merit team was composed of Chen Xi, Gong Yingjing (Leader), Song Anan and Zeng Qi. 13,000 RMB and a trophy were awarded to the Champion team and the Merit team was granted 1,000 RMB cash prize. Students in Champion team also obtained an internship opportunity at famous CPA firms in Hong Kong.
At the Celebration Ceremony, Prof. Ching-Fai Ng, President of UIC, spoke highly of UIC students' outstanding performance. He also expressed his appreciation of student participants’ positive attitude and efforts. President Ng and Vice President Prof. Zee Sze Yong awarded to winners and the students who participated in the competition respectively. Vice President Prof. Zhang Cong, Associate Vice President Dr. Wendy Chan, Dean of Division of Business and Management Prof. Stella Cho and coach teacher Mr. Joseph Liang and Mr. Ben Wong were present at the ceremony.

The Qualification Programme (QP) Case Analysis Competition was an inter-tertiary event aimed at developing students' business skills, cultivating professional judgment and preparing themselves for real business environment. The Competition has carved a niche among local universities and received accolades and support from eminent professionals and academics across the profession. In firstly Competition held in PRC in 2009, UIC students did a very good job and won the Second Prize and Merit Award.
